How does Footlab compute this prediction?

The model combines both teams' Elo ratings (anchored by competition pool), their recent form weighted by opponent strength, home advantage and a Poisson matrix for scorelines. Its accuracy is measured continuously on the predictions actually published. Methodology and measured accuracy
